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.03.27;
Скачать: CL | DM;

Вниз

Работа с временем и датой.   Найти похожие ветки 

 
digester ©   (2003-03-09 12:34) [0]

Уважаемые мастера!Возник вопрос: есть table1,dbgrid1(с тремя индексами),3-тий индекс типа TDatetime. Хочу, чтобы, когда в dbgrid"е, в какой нибудь записи было указано опрделеённое время - в этот момент выдавалось messagedialog к примеру.(timer1 у меня висит на форме)только вот нихрена не получается :(
Пишу так и ничего:

procedure TForm1.Timer1Timer(Sender: TObject);
begin
Label4.Caption:=TimeToStr(Time);
Edit2.Text:=TimeToStr(DBGrid3.Fields[2].AsDateTime);
Edit1.Text:=timetostr(time);

if DBGrid3.Fields[2].AsDateTime=Time then
Begin
ShowMessage("YYYYYEEEEEESSSSSSS");
End;
inc(i);
Edit3.Text:=floattostr(i);
DBGrid3.Refresh;
end;


 
Романов Р.В. ©   (2003-03-09 13:30) [1]


> if DBGrid3.Fields[2].AsDateTime=Time then

Сравнивай дробную часть этих чисел. Используй знак >=


 
sunrider   (2003-03-09 23:17) [2]

Или приведи обе части равенства к одному типу на пример к string
Кстати не понятно как в данном примере находится строка базы
с нужным временем



Страницы: 1 вся ветка

Текущий архив: 2003.03.27;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.02 c
14-88205
vendoor
2003-03-11 14:00
2003.03.27
Помогите найти SUIPACK + CRACK к нему


1-87890
LoCKeR
2003-03-16 12:49
2003.03.27
Как показать файлы, как в проводнике?


3-87793
Behemoth
2003-03-07 12:01
2003.03.27
Поможите настроить псевдоним через ODBC


1-88050
anton_cor
2003-03-15 01:18
2003.03.27
Напечатать бланк


3-87827
PrettyFly
2003-03-10 10:46
2003.03.27
NULL